1. Tour Guide System Definition
Combination of a mobile audio transmitter used by the presenter/speaker(s) to make sure that the attendees/visitors (tour) are able to understand the audio via a mobile receiver, also known as the tour guide audio system.

2. Purpose of the Trip Guide system
The System is used to support mobile tours and to overcome potential background noise. It can also be used for multilingual content delivery during small events.

3. Components of Tour Guide System
A Tour counselor System consists of a mobile Audio Transmitter with an integrated microphone, a set of wireless tour guide system, and charging solutions.

4. Use of Tour Guide system
Tour Guide System can be used for indoor and outdoor events, conferences, and touring events. Globibo’s Trip counselor Systems are small and portable making it very user-friendly.

Tour Guide System Transmitter

Tour Guide System Transmitter

The basic Tour Guide or Mobile Interpretation System Infrastructure requires the right transmitters. Transmitters determine the range in which headsets can receive the audio transmission. Furthermore, most transmitters are capable of broadcasting several parallel channels, for example in an environment in which interpreters translate the presentation into different languages.

As Tour Guide Transmitters have to be portable, we also consult you in matters such as weight, broadcast reach, and battery time. Our experienced team of engineers also supports you with technical challenges or potential interferences in specific environments. We carry different Tour counselor Systems in different countries. The corresponding transmitter options have slightly different configurations based on the country and project setup.

Transmitters are also battery-powered to ensure mobility.

Tour Guide System Microphones

Tour Guide System Microphone

Tour guide microphone systems come with a variety of different microphones to ensure the presenter is understood in the right environment. The right microphones are not just determined by the transmission technology but also by the presentation environment (e.g., a noisy factory or windy weather). Furthermore, microphones may have to be waterproof and provide an independent power supply for a specific number of hours. To learn more about the different types of microphones, please contact us.

Tour Guide System - Technical Information

Tour Guide System Headsets

Tour Guide System Receiver We carry different Tour Guide System headset models in different countries. The receiver itself can be combined with different headsets. Every model has advantages and disadvantages as well as technical configuration. Some example models are listed below.
  • Frequency Range: 470-510 MHz
  • Oscillation Mode: PLL Synthesized
  • Pre-set Channels: 99 channels
  • Switching Bandwidth: 12MHz
  • Channel Grid: 250KHz
  • RF Output Power: 10mW
  • Sensitivity: Approx Approx.-102dBm
  • Operating Range : Up to 300 meters / 530 feet (line-of-sight)
  • Frequency Response: 50Hz~12KHz
  • Display: LCD Display Backlit LCD display
  • Power Supply Receiver and Transmitter: rechargeable lithium battery
  • Operating Time: Up to 14-20 hours
  • Dimensions: 70mmX 55mmX16mm
  • Weight Transmitter and Receiver: 65g

Tour Guide System FAQ

Q1. Is Tour Guide Systems One-way or two-way?
Ans: Tour guide systems are generally one-way which means it only allows guide speakers to communicate with the visitors. The visitors are given headphones on which they can listen to the instructions passed on by the guide. Although there are some two-way tour guide systems available as well.

Q2. Is it hard to use tour guide systems?
Ans: Not at all! In fact, tour guide systems are quite easy to operate. You do not need any special guidelines or instructions to use them. Anyone handling a tour guide system can comfortably work with it without any experience.

Q3. What does Globibo’s Tour Guide Systems include?
Ans: We have a complete range of tour guide systems options you need. Globibo has tour guide system headsets, transmitters, infrastructure, and microphones. We can take care of your tour guide systems requirements for any occasion.

Q4. Why would I need a Trip Guide System?
Ans: Conversations/messages can be misconstrued if they do not reach the recipient directly and without interference. A reliable Trip counselor system would be able to address voices that are too soft, situations when background noise that is too loud, or when addressing big gatherings of people.

Q5. Where and when can I use a Trip Guide System?
Ans: Two examples of places and instances where a Trip counselor System could be used are as follows. Our Trip counselor system is portable and easy to use. It can be used at the workplace, for e.g. a factory where the noise level is high that it could be difficult if you are training new staff, or showing visitors around the factory.
The system can also be used when conducting tours, indoors or outdoors (even in a bus). The Trip counselor is able to talk, without shouting to the tourists even amidst traffic.

Q6. The tour guide system seems complicating and I am not technical savvy. Is the system easy to use?
Ans: Our Tour Guide system is easy to use and you need not be technical savvy to use it. You would need to just take the microphone and switch it on. Once you are done with using it, just place the receiver in the charger/storage case for the next event.

Q7. Do we need batteries for the Trip Guide System?
Ans: Most Tour counselor systems have in-built rechargeable batteries. They are charged via standard USB cables, depending on the battery level. Specific charging trays and cases facilitate the charging of many units at the same time. Trip guide systems are optimized for low battery consumption to last for 2-3 days without charging.

Q8. What is the range of the Tour Guide system?
Ans: The transmission range of the Trip counselor System varies from model to model, based on the output power and frequency. Standard Trip counselor systems have a reliable range of 30-50 meters.

Q9. How many channels are supported in a tour guide system?
Ans: Different manufacturers offer different options in regards to the number of channels. In most projects, not more than 10 channels or languages are required. The models provided for our Clients usually have 99 channels.

Q10. How many receivers can a transmitter support?
Ans: The number of receivers that a transmitter can support varies from system to system. Our trip counselor system transmitter can support 100 to 1000 receivers simultaneously. As general benchmarks we use the following numbers: A portable transmitter supports up to 100 receivers and a stationary transmitter supports up to 10,000 receivers.

Tour Guide System Microphone Options

The Tour Guide System Transmitter requires a microphone for the speaker. The microphones can be different based on the convenience of the speaker and setup of the event.
For more information please check out Tour Guide System Microphones.

Neckband Microphones

A standard option is the neckband microphone. It allows the hands-free operation and therefore the largest comfort to the speaker. The microphone direction itself is adjustable.

Neckband Tour Guide System Microphones

Cabled Hand-held Microphones

Cabled TGS microphones are another option for Tours. Speakers and Trip Guides may have different personal preferences. Often the neckband microphones are more convenient but have lower audio-quality. The cabled hand-held microphones are slightly less convenient but may provide better audio-quality.

Cabled Hand-held Microphones

Lapel Microphones

The Lapel Microphone is clipped to the collar / blouse / jacket of the speaker and is another hands-free option for the speaker. It is also called clip-on microphone.

Lapel Microphones

Wireless Hand-held Microphones

A large variety of Wireless microphones provide some more comfort to the speaker. The range between the microphone and base station is determined by the specific model and can vary largely.

Wireless Hand-held Microphones
